it's an Ozone so that speaks to high quality build/materials and it's Ozone's low/medium aspect ratio (AR) so that speaks to beginner/intermediate level.
it's been flown 3 times doesn't tell much it could have been "flown" high speed into the concrete ground a 1000 times in the course of 3 flights or it could have been set up, launched/flown for 2 seconds and put away on 3 occaisions. or anything in between.
you'd have to see feel.
if it's in good to near mint condition (which is what i would infer the condition to be from the seller stating its only been flown 3 times) 90 is super low price.
However...the Ozone Little Devil model has been discontinued for I'd say nearly 8 years. LD has been succeeded by the Samurai, Samurai II, and then the Flow (and now maybe something else). Unless your are looking at an old advertisement or the buyer bought it new from someone's closet i would ask a couple more questions about age.
I believe Ozone advertised the new FLow (when it was new) as being more like the "orignal" Little Devil than the two versions of Samerais.
That Little Devil will be more than adequate as longs as it (and it's lines/handles) is in decent condition. Get some KKs.

Awesome price on a great staple of a kite. Although the LD is a very old model (first power kite introduced by Ozone), it is an awesome one. We have several people here in our group that still use the Little Devils and they are still working exceptionally well after all these years - and in our environment of the dry lakebeds, that really says a ton about these kites and their quality.

My kids have a 1.5 Lil Devil and it has served them well. Bridle lines are knotted, not sewn but they are done nicely (and may be sewn on the larger models). I find it a pit more finicky theyn their 1.2 sting and IIRC it lacks dirt outs (maybe not, but I think it does) but it is rather bomb proof.

I often fly it like a rev / sport kite on days they put it away and that's fun - its rather nimble.

I've kite skied with it on a ballistic day. If the 3m is like the 1.5, it should serve your wife and you well.

Do it
I have two of these one in the size ur talking about
They are bomb proof
Pull like trucks lots of low grunt but not hardly any lift
In a buggy once u get clipping along they are hard to beat upwind and they just seem to feed on aparent wind
Better than the sammi in my opinion
